Course Content

• Introduction to Smart Quality Control Systems and Industry 4.0
• Data Acquisition and Analysis for Quality Control (using IoT sensors, Statistical Process Control)
• Predictive Maintenance and Quality Control using Machine Learning
• Implementing Smart Quality Control using AI and Deep Learning
• Cybersecurity in Smart Quality Control Systems
• Digital Twin Technology for Quality Control Optimization
• Blockchain Technology for Traceability and Quality Assurance
• Case Studies in Smart Quality Control Implementation and Best Practices
• Smart Quality Control System Design and Implementation
• Advanced Analytics and Reporting for Smart Quality Control

Career path

Career Role (Smart Quality Control) Description
Quality Control Specialist (Smart Systems) Develop and implement advanced quality control processes leveraging AI and data analytics in manufacturing. High demand for automation and data analysis skills.
Smart Manufacturing Engineer (Quality Focus) Design, implement, and maintain smart quality control systems in manufacturing environments. Strong emphasis on predictive maintenance and IoT integration.
Data Analyst (Smart Quality Control) Analyze large datasets from smart quality control systems to identify trends, anomalies and improve efficiency. Expert in statistical analysis and data visualization.
Quality Assurance Engineer (AI/ML) Develop and implement AI/ML-powered quality control solutions. Requires proficiency in machine learning algorithms and software development.
